- Title
Polymorphisms in base-excision & nucleotide-excision repair genes & prostate cancer risk in north Indian population.
- Authors
Mandal, Raju K; Gangwar, Ruchika; Kapoor, Rakesh; Mittal, Rama Devi
- Abstract
Genetic variation in the DNA repair genes might be associated with altered DNA repair capacities (DRC). Reduced DRC due to inherited polymorphisms may increase the susceptibility to cancers. Base excision and nucleotide excision are the two major repair pathways. We investigated the association between two base excision repair (BER) genes (APE1 exon 5, OGG1 exon 7) and two nucleotide excision repair (NER) genes (XPC PAT, XPC exon 15) with risk of prostate cancer (PCa).
